The PHBOGFC is nearly 8000 pages, and consists of specific fonts from the Google Font library. The fonts we chose are those that have a complete character set. As anyone that has browsed Google Fonts or any of the other free font repositories we all know and love knows, not all typefaces are created equal. Some are missing important characters for one reason or another. Perhaps a font is designed as a “display” font, with no need for special characters. You want to know that sooner than later when exploring typeface pairings.

Regardless, nothing is more frustrating than looking for and finding a typeface, committing to its personality and style, only to find out after you’ve downloaded, installed, and started using it that you discover it’s missing an “@” symbol. Speaking from experience here!
